Greta

The Illogical Thriller - 6/10

by This Is My Review

If a story is not convincing, you cannot really sympathize or even connect with the characters. “Greta” had a good start, with great potential for an interesting story development, unfortunately after the second act things became illogical which ruined the whole experience for me. Many scenes seemed fake without a proper character transformation. Greta started as a psychopath but she was later transformed into an unbeatable human being. What bothered me is the fact that these illogical actions were just there to increase the movie’s runtime and to give the story a purpose. I enjoyed the movie’s atmosphere, the tone was good and some scenes were thrilling. Isabelle Huppert was stunning, as if the role was written for her. She was creepy and convicing, you will feel afraid by just looking at her. Chloe Moretz did a great job, she has potential and that’s definitely not her best performance. “Greta” is a good and enjoyable thriller that took a wrong illogical path after a good start.
